新聞中心
在現(xiàn)如今的互聯(lián)網(wǎng)時(shí)代,IP地址是最基本也是最重要的網(wǎng)絡(luò)標(biāo)識(shí)之一,在Linux系統(tǒng)中,我們經(jīng)常需要查看和分析訪問(wèn)IP地址的記錄。這篇文章將會(huì)教你如何在Linux系統(tǒng)中查看訪問(wèn)IP記錄。

創(chuàng)新互聯(lián)建站專(zhuān)注于盧氏網(wǎng)站建設(shè)服務(wù)及定制,我們擁有豐富的企業(yè)做網(wǎng)站經(jīng)驗(yàn)。 熱誠(chéng)為您提供盧氏營(yíng)銷(xiāo)型網(wǎng)站建設(shè),盧氏網(wǎng)站制作、盧氏網(wǎng)頁(yè)設(shè)計(jì)、盧氏網(wǎng)站官網(wǎng)定制、成都小程序開(kāi)發(fā)服務(wù),打造盧氏網(wǎng)絡(luò)公司原創(chuàng)品牌,更為您提供盧氏網(wǎng)站排名全網(wǎng)營(yíng)銷(xiāo)落地服務(wù)。
Linux系統(tǒng)記錄訪問(wèn)日志的方式
Linux系統(tǒng)中,記錄訪問(wèn)IP日志有多種方式,每種方式都有其優(yōu)缺點(diǎn)。以下是常用的記錄訪問(wèn)IP日志的方式:
1. 利用系統(tǒng)審計(jì)日志
Linux系統(tǒng)提供了一個(gè)叫做auditd的工具,可以用來(lái)監(jiān)控系統(tǒng)中的各種事件,包括用戶(hù)登錄、文件訪問(wèn)、進(jìn)程啟動(dòng)等等。根據(jù)系統(tǒng)管理員的設(shè)置,auditd工具可以記錄下每一個(gè)事件的細(xì)節(jié)信息,例如事件的類(lèi)型、時(shí)間、用戶(hù)、進(jìn)程、IP地址等信息。通過(guò)查詢(xún)審計(jì)日志,可以快速定位某個(gè)IP地址的訪問(wèn)記錄。
使用auditd工具記錄訪問(wèn)IP的主要優(yōu)點(diǎn)是記錄的信息比較全面、詳細(xì),可以滿(mǎn)足安全審計(jì)和故障排查等需求,但是它也存在一些缺點(diǎn),例如會(huì)消耗系統(tǒng)資源,需要對(duì)審計(jì)規(guī)則進(jìn)行精細(xì)的配置和管理。
2. 利用Web服務(wù)器日志
Web服務(wù)器是一個(gè)常見(jiàn)的基礎(chǔ)設(shè)施,它可以記錄訪問(wèn)者的訪問(wèn)請(qǐng)求,并記錄下請(qǐng)求的相關(guān)信息,例如請(qǐng)求的URL、瀏覽器類(lèi)型、來(lái)源IP等等。在Linux系統(tǒng)中,常見(jiàn)的Web服務(wù)器有Apache、Nginx、Tomcat等等。這些服務(wù)器都提供了日志記錄功能,可以記錄下訪問(wèn)者的IP地址。
使用Web服務(wù)器記錄訪問(wèn)IP的主要優(yōu)點(diǎn)是Web服務(wù)器本身就是一個(gè)相關(guān)性很強(qiáng)的組件,可以輕松地進(jìn)行信息統(tǒng)計(jì)和分析,而且可以根據(jù)不同的訪問(wèn)類(lèi)型,選擇不同的日志記錄方式。但是Web服務(wù)器日志還是有一些局限性,例如無(wú)法記錄除Web訪問(wèn)之外的其它訪問(wèn),例如FTP、SSH、郵件等。
3. 利用系統(tǒng)內(nèi)核日志
Linux系統(tǒng)內(nèi)核有一個(gè)叫做syslog的服務(wù),它可以記錄下系統(tǒng)內(nèi)核的各種事件和錯(cuò)誤,例如內(nèi)存泄露、磁盤(pán)錯(cuò)誤、系統(tǒng)調(diào)用等等。syslog服務(wù)提供了一個(gè)靈活的機(jī)制,可以由管理員定義不同的日志級(jí)別和不同的目標(biāo)文件,以滿(mǎn)足不同的日志記錄需求。
使用syslog服務(wù)記錄訪問(wèn)IP的主要優(yōu)點(diǎn)是它可以記錄系統(tǒng)內(nèi)核級(jí)別的日志事件,可以精確地定位系統(tǒng)異常和錯(cuò)誤,而且可以快速地進(jìn)行日志分析和查詢(xún)。但是syslog服務(wù)的缺點(diǎn)在于它只記錄內(nèi)核級(jí)別的事件,對(duì)于普通的應(yīng)用程序訪問(wèn)事件記錄比較麻煩。
linux查看訪問(wèn)ip記錄
在Linux系統(tǒng)中,查看訪問(wèn)IP記錄的方式有多種,可以根據(jù)不同的日志存儲(chǔ)方式進(jìn)行查詢(xún)。
1. 查看系統(tǒng)審計(jì)日志記錄
如果使用auditd工具記錄訪問(wèn)IP,可以使用aureport命令進(jìn)行日志查詢(xún),例如查詢(xún)最近一小時(shí)內(nèi)的訪問(wèn)IP記錄可以使用命令:
aureport –start now-1h –event –success –client-ip -i
上面的命令中,–start參數(shù)指定起始時(shí)間,–event參數(shù)指定事件類(lèi)型,–success參數(shù)指定成功的事件,–client-ip參數(shù)指定IP地址,-i參數(shù)指定輸出格式為表格。
2. 查看Web服務(wù)器日志記錄
如果使用Web服務(wù)器記錄訪問(wèn)IP,可以使用cat命令、grep命令等進(jìn)行日志查詢(xún),例如查詢(xún)最近一周內(nèi)的訪問(wèn)IP記錄可以使用命令:
cat /var/log/nginx/access.log | grep ‘2023/11/’ | awk ‘{print $1}’ | sort | uniq -c | sort -rn
上面的命令中,cat命令用于讀取日志文件內(nèi)容,grep命令用于過(guò)濾出指定日期的記錄,awk命令用于提取出IP地址字段,sort命令和uniq命令則用于統(tǒng)計(jì)IP地址訪問(wèn)次數(shù)和去重,最后sort命令用于按照次數(shù)進(jìn)行倒序排序。
3. 查看系統(tǒng)內(nèi)核日志記錄
如果使用syslog服務(wù)記錄訪問(wèn)IP,可以使用journalctl命令進(jìn)行日志查詢(xún),例如查詢(xún)最近一天內(nèi)的訪問(wèn)IP記錄可以使用命令:
journalctl –since ‘1 day ago’ | grep ‘Accepted publickey’
上面的命令中,journalctl命令用于讀取系統(tǒng)內(nèi)核日志,–since參數(shù)用于指定起始時(shí)間,grep命令用于過(guò)濾出SSH登錄成功的日志記錄。
上述介紹了Linux系統(tǒng)中記錄訪問(wèn)IP的三種方法,每種方法都有利弊之處,可以根據(jù)不同的需求選擇不同的日志記錄方式。同時(shí),也提供了查看訪問(wèn)IP記錄的方法和命令,可以根據(jù)實(shí)際情況進(jìn)行查詢(xún)和分析。希望這篇文章對(duì)初學(xué)者有所幫助。
成都網(wǎng)站建設(shè)公司-創(chuàng)新互聯(lián)為您提供網(wǎng)站建設(shè)、網(wǎng)站制作、網(wǎng)頁(yè)設(shè)計(jì)及定制高端網(wǎng)站建設(shè)服務(wù)!
Linux下怎樣查看一個(gè)文件被哪些IP訪問(wèn)過(guò)
netstat -nat 或者 netstat -nau 查看進(jìn)程的通州返信 如果要寫(xiě)入文件 在后畝跡孝面加上 netstat -nat > 文件 & 在樣會(huì)在后臺(tái)執(zhí)行迅稿
linux 如何調(diào)出上網(wǎng)歷史記錄(用IP分類(lèi),因?yàn)橛卸鄠€(gè)ip)用程序?qū)崿F(xiàn)
用squid
然后用程序處理squid的log文件即可
大型的企業(yè)用idc可以實(shí)現(xiàn),將用戶(hù)瀏覽過(guò)的網(wǎng)站猜渣,發(fā)送過(guò)的郵件都能還原。
如果你要用iptable來(lái)實(shí)現(xiàn),正喊恐穗清悄怕不行
你可以用iptables來(lái)記錄一個(gè)ip進(jìn)出記錄
iptables -A INPUT -d ip -j log
iptables -A OUTPUT -s ip -j log
這個(gè)說(shuō)來(lái)也不簡(jiǎn)單脊笑
你的環(huán)境?
iptables代理
還是兆埋其他族野螞
還是squid針對(duì)不同環(huán)境 操作方式不同
squid是代理上網(wǎng)告殲的方法,在企業(yè)中使用會(huì)很麻煩。
linux作為防火墻,編一個(gè)小程序暫無(wú)法實(shí)現(xiàn)你的需求。
建議有錢(qián)還是鋒鄭購(gòu)買(mǎi)專(zhuān)門(mén)的流量監(jiān)控設(shè)襪基沖備吧。
兔#子動(dòng)態(tài)IP
是一款功派租念能強(qiáng)大的IP地址轉(zhuǎn)換軟件,連接速度很快,
能夠修改電腦或者手機(jī)的IP地址功能, 隱藏我自己真實(shí)的IP,
可以用于注冊(cè), 投票塵困, 用鼠標(biāo)點(diǎn)擊, 刷單, 網(wǎng)站seo等等。
1:下載IP軟件
2:選擇型巧全國(guó)300個(gè)城市連接
環(huán)境:WinXP/Vista/Win7/Win8/Win10/手機(jī)
解決游戲掛機(jī)延遲
怎么查看從哪個(gè)ip登陸linux做了哪些操作
who >/etc/profile
> history
>
> USER=`whoami`
>
> USER_IP=`who -u am i 2>/dev/null| awk ‘{print $NF}’|sed -e ‘s///g’`
>
> if ; then
> USER_IP=`hostname`
> fi
>
> if ; then
> mkdir /tmp/history
> chmod 777 /tmp/history
> fi
>
> if ; then
> mkdir /tmp/history/${LOGNAME}
> chmod 300 /tmp/history/${LOGNAME}
> fi
>
> export HISTSIZE=4096
>
> DT=`date +”%Y-%m-%d_%H:%M:%S”`
>
> export HISTFILE=”/tmp/history/${LOGNAME}/${USER}@${USER_IP}_history.$DT”
>
> chmod 600 /tmp/history/${LOGNAME}/*history* 2>/dev/null
>
> EOF
# source /etc/profile
# logout
# 此時(shí)需要退出系統(tǒng)再重新登錄,在/tmp/history/目錄下才有記錄
通過(guò)上面的腳本代碼在系統(tǒng)的/tmp下就新建了個(gè)history目錄(這個(gè)目錄可以自定義),在目錄中記錄了所有的登陸過(guò)系統(tǒng)的用戶(hù)和IP地址,然后進(jìn)入/tmp/history目錄查看歷史記錄:
# cd /tmp
# ll
總計(jì) 24
drwxroot root11 gconfd-root
drwxrwxrwx 3 root root11 history
drwxroot root:11 keyring-Ki8IOJ
srwxr-xr-x 1 root rootmapping-root
srwroot rootscim-panel-socket:0-root
drwxroot root11 ssh-jPPigl3182
drwxroot root:16 ssh-KDmPtr3350
# cd history/
# ll
總計(jì) 4
d-wxroot root:16 root
# cd root/
# ll
總計(jì) 4
-rwroot root:16 :16:42
#此時(shí)就在記錄中可以查看到用戶(hù)名和IP地址,對(duì)Linux系統(tǒng)操作的命令和時(shí)間。
關(guān)于linux查看訪問(wèn)ip記錄的介紹到此就結(jié)束了,不知道你從中找到你需要的信息了嗎 ?如果你還想了解更多這方面的信息,記得收藏關(guān)注本站。
四川成都云服務(wù)器租用托管【創(chuàng)新互聯(lián)】提供各地服務(wù)器租用,電信服務(wù)器托管、移動(dòng)服務(wù)器托管、聯(lián)通服務(wù)器托管,云服務(wù)器虛擬主機(jī)租用。成都機(jī)房托管咨詢(xún):13518219792
創(chuàng)新互聯(lián)(www.cdcxhl.com)擁有10多年的服務(wù)器租用、服務(wù)器托管、云服務(wù)器、虛擬主機(jī)、網(wǎng)站系統(tǒng)開(kāi)發(fā)經(jīng)驗(yàn)、開(kāi)啟建站+互聯(lián)網(wǎng)銷(xiāo)售服務(wù),與企業(yè)客戶(hù)共同成長(zhǎng),共創(chuàng)價(jià)值。
網(wǎng)頁(yè)題目:如何Linux查看訪問(wèn)IP記錄?(linux查看訪問(wèn)ip記錄)
路徑分享:http://m.5511xx.com/article/dhdosig.html


咨詢(xún)
建站咨詢(xún)
